P15: Millennial leaders - the essential guide

Episode 15 of the Psychology@Work podcast, hosted by Dr Paul Brewerton, titled "P15: Millennial leaders - the essential guide" was published on May 30, 2021 and runs 53 minutes.

May 30, 2021 ·53m · Psychology@Work

Today I will be talking to Rebecca Christianson about the experience of being a Millennial senior leader and Executive – both the opportunities and the challenges.

This podversation is focused on those Millennial leaders themselves, but will be interesting for P&C professionals and other interested senior leaders wanting to better understand their peers.

Some key takeaways you will discover:

  • Why you need to listen to millennials!
  • Why many millennials leave more traditional organisations
  • Who said “when they go low, you go high”
  • Why self-care is fundamental to millennial leaders
